- Puerto Rican Governor Aníbal Salvador Acevedo Vilá and twelve others are charged with election fraud. (Reuters)
- Germany scraps plans to build the Transrapid high-speed monorail link between the Bavarian capital Munich and its airport because of a massive overrun in costs. (Deutsche Welle)

- The oldest known recording of a human voice, created with a phonautograph by Édouard-Léon Scott de Martinville on April 9 1860 is discovered by American researchers. (New York Times)
